question 25 (1 point) which pair of angles between 0° and 360° satisfies \\( \sin \theta=-\frac{1}{\sqrt{2}} \\)? a) \\( 45^{circ} \\) and \\( 0^{circ} \\) b) \\( -45^{circ} \\) and \\( 225^{circ} \\) c) \\( 45^{circ} \\) and \\( 135^{circ} \\) d) \\( 225^{circ} \\) and \\( 315^{circ} \\)

Explanation:

Step1: Recall the unit - circle values

We know that \(\sin45^{\circ}=\frac{1}{\sqrt{2}}\). Since \(\sin\theta =-\frac{1}{\sqrt{2}}\), we need to find angles in the third and fourth quadrants (where sine is negative).

Step2: Calculate the angles in the third and fourth quadrants

For the third - quadrant angle: \(\theta = 180^{\circ}+45^{\circ}=225^{\circ}\)
For the fourth - quadrant angle: \(\theta = 360^{\circ}-45^{\circ}=315^{\circ}\)

Answer:

D. \(225^{\circ}\) and \(315^{\circ}\)
